Market Review and Technological Breakthroughs
Currently, the major players on the market include international companies such as LNJNBio, Promega, Takara Biography, and others. These business not only give traditional silica gel membrane column-based and magnetic bead approach RNA extraction items yet are additionally dedicated to developing extra effective and convenient automated remedies. Recently, the application of nanotechnology and microfluidic chip innovation has actually changed RNA removal. RNA extraction methods based upon nanomaterials enable greater purity and recovery prices, while microfluidic systems use the opportunity of fast, micro-volume sample processing, which substantially enhances speculative efficiency. However, the application of high-precision tools and new materials usually comes with a high price, limiting the appeal of particular innovative technologies in regular labs. On top of that, the variety and complexity of example kinds make RNA extraction challenging, especially for clinical samples, where making sure the stability and non-contamination of RNA is vital.

Growth of Application Fields
Along with conventional standard research, the applications of RNA removal reagents are increasing. In very early cancer cells testing, fluid biopsy technology is becoming a non-invasive diagnostic device that relies on flowing lump RNA isolated from blood for early cancer medical diagnosis. In virus security, RNA extraction technology can help swiftly determine arising virus and provide a scientific basis for public wellness decision-making. And in farming breeding, by drawing out and evaluating plant RNA, scientists can much better recognize the hereditary features of plants and thus reproduce better ranges. Additionally, RNA extraction reagents have a large range of applications in environmental protection, food safety and security and various other areas, contributing to the solution of worldwide issues.
